Summary
Researchers at the University of Virginia have conducted a groundbreaking study that sheds light on what happens when there are errors in the division of brain cells during growth. This research could pave the way for new treatments for cancer and various developmental disorders of the brain. By understanding how defective cells are removed, it may also be possible to prevent many birth defects. The implications are vast, potentially impacting companies like CNS Pharmaceuticals Inc. (NASDAQ: CNSP), which focus on neurological and oncological therapies. The study highlights the critical role of cell division accuracy in brain development and disease.
